15 May 2007: Prizes galore in water efficiency campaign Print


Visitors to B&Q stores have the chance to find out how to avoid wasting water in and around the home.

A free lifestyle magazine containing tips and advice will be available in selected stores from May 19 for a fortnight.

The publication, called Summer fun, is being provided by 16 UK water companies in conjunction with Waterwise and B&Q. Around 450,000 magazines are to be distributed from more than 150 stores.

And there are some great prizes – city hotel breaks, health club memberships and B&Q vouchers – to be won exclusively by customers of the participating water companies.

The prizes can be won as part of a draw in which customers fill in and return a questionnaire which seeks to find out their views and knowledge about water use. In addition, all readers have the chance to try out a Cannons Health Club for a weekend simply by clipping out a coupon.

The magazine features loads of fascinating facts about water use and tips to avoid wasting it, together with an interview with TV presenter Ben Fogle, who reveals why water is important to him.

Jacob Tompkins, Director of Waterwise, said: ‘This spring has been the hottest and driest on record. In addition the past year has also been the warmest on record. We live in a much warmer climate than we did 30 years ago. This combined with population growth and an increased use of water means we will see more supply problems in the future.’

‘People think we live in a rainy country so they can be forgiven for not fully understanding the importance of using water carefully. But we’ve all got a responsibility to reduce the amount of water we use each day to avoid problems in the long term. This magazine gives practical tips and advice as to how to do just that.’

Ian Cheshire, Chief Executive of B&Q adds “At B&Q, our priority is to show our consumers that there are lots of easy, and affordable, steps that can be taken to save water wastage without limiting use. From adapting your toilet to be dual flush - to installing a water butt in the garden - you can make a real difference and we can show you how.”

• Waterwise is an independent, not for profit, non-governmental organisation focused on decreasing water consumption in the UK by 2010 and building the evidence base for large scale water efficiency. We are the leading authority on water efficiency in the UK. We sit on the UK Environment Minister’s Water Saving Group alongside the water industry and regulators.
